Flood Watch issued August 30 at 9:54AM MST until September 1 at 12:00AM MST by NWS Flagstaff AZ
* WHAT...Flash flooding caused by excessive rainfall continues to be possible. * WHERE...All of northern and central Arizona. * WHEN...From 2 PM MST /3 PM MDT/ this afternoon through Monday evening. * IMPACTS...Flash flooding will be pos…

A flash‑flood watch has been issued for all of northern and central Arizona, effective from 2 PM MST (3 PM MDT) this afternoon through Monday evening. The National Weather Service warns that excessive rainfall could cause flash flooding in creeks, normally dry washes, swimming holes, and recently burned areas. The watch remains in force until 12:00 AM MST on September 1.
